Closeouts. No matter how many games you play, the 780 Court Shoe from New Balance will perform again and again. NDurance® compound on outsole provides durability on hard court surfaces Aggressive herringbone tread for traction on clay or grassStability Web® for lightweight midfoot supportCompression molded EVA midsoleAbzorb® cushioning in the heel and forefootDurable toecapLeather uppersWeight: 1 lb. 10 oz. pr.
